  It's Iron deficiency day today so I've decided to share some basic info about IRON!  🤔 IRON? Can eat one ah? 🤔 What is Iron? Iron is an essential mineral that helps to transport oxygen throughout the body.  Iron is an important component of  hemoglobin , the substance in red  blood cells  that carries oxygen from your  lungs  to transport it throughout your body.  If you don't have enough iron, your body can't make enough healthy red  blood cells.  Insufficient healthy red blood cells will cause insufficient oxygen in the body which then cause fatigued.  It can also affect everything from brain  function to immune system. If you're  pregnant , severe iron deficiency may increase your baby's risk of being born too early, or smaller than normal. Where do I get Iron? Vegetarian Diet in Healthy Way

Vegetarian diet has become a leading trend in recent years, it could be due to religion beliefs, health issues, environmental awareness or simply not to kill. Regardless of the reasons behind, one thing for sure is that risks of getting cardiovascular diseases (heart diseases) in vegetarians are definitely lower than meat-eaters. One study has found that typical vegetarian live about 3.5 years longer than meat-eaters. However, studies have shown that there are often some sort of nutrients deficiency in vegetarians, such as vitamin B12, proteins, omega-3 fatty acids, calcium. Vegetarian diet isn't necessarily healthy, you still need to eat a balance diet to stay fit. After all, French fries and potato chips are animal free but that doesn't mean they are healthy. When it comes to vegetarian diet, variety is the key.
